Ageing Wisely is a cognitive behavioural therapy program for older adults living in the community with anxiety and/or depression.
Suitable for adults aged 60 years+.

The therapist kit includes:
• 1 x Ageing Wisely Individual or Group Therapy Client Workbook
• 1 x Ageing Wisely Therapist Manual
• (Note: The therapist manual covers the delivery of all versions of the Ageing Wisely Suite of programs).
The therapist’s manual describes in detail the rationale for each skill covered in the Ageing Wisely program, how to help clients develop and practise the skills, including exercises and tips to assist successful skill implementation.
